Overview of T-Shirt Manufacturing Process

What is T Shirt Manufacturing and How Does it Work?

The T-shirt manufacturing process is both fascinating and complex. It involves several steps, starting from design to the final product. Designers often sketch ideas or digital mockups. Once the design is approved, materials need to be selected. Cotton and polyester are popular choices. The type of fabric can affect the final look and feel. A poor choice can lead to disappointment.

After materials are chosen, the cutting stage begins. Large fabric rolls are laid out and cut into pieces. Precision is key here; one mistake can ruin multiple shirts. Next, the pieces are sewn together. This requires skilled labor to ensure quality stitching. Some manufacturers use machines for efficiency. However, this can lead to less attention to detail.

Printing designs on T-shirts is another crucial step. There are various techniques, such as screen printing or direct-to-garment printing. Each method has its own strengths and weaknesses. Quality control is essential throughout. Inspecting each shirt for flaws can be tedious. Flaws can occur at any stage. It’s a continuous learning process to improve production standards.

Materials Used in T-Shirt Production

T-shirt manufacturing relies heavily on materials. The most common fabric is cotton, which accounts for about 56% of the global market. Cotton is favored for its softness and breathability. Organic cotton is gaining traction, appealing to environmentally conscious consumers. However, the supply chain can be complex, often raising sustainability concerns.

Polyester is another popular choice. It comprises roughly 30% of T-shirt production. This synthetic fiber is durable and wrinkle-resistant, yet it has a significant environmental impact due to microplastic shedding. Innovations aim to improve recycling processes, but many challenges remain. Blends of cotton and polyester are widely used too, creating garments that combine comfort and functionality.

Other materials, like bamboo and hemp, are emerging options. Bamboo is eco-friendly but can be costly to process. Hemp offers durability and a smaller ecological footprint yet faces a stigma related to its association with cannabis. The T-shirt industry must address these material challenges to ensure a sustainable future. The market demands more environmentally friendly options, yet cost and consumer habits often hinder progress.

Step-by-Step Construction of a T-Shirt

The process of T-shirt manufacturing begins with selecting fabric. Cotton is a popular choice. It’s soft and breathable. However, blends can offer better durability. After choosing fabric, patterns are created. These patterns determine the T-shirt’s shape and size.

Cutting comes next. Fabric pieces are carefully laid out and cut with precision. This step requires attention to detail. Sometimes, miscalculations happen, leading to waste. Once cut, the pieces are sewn together. Here, machines play a crucial role. Still, skilled hands are necessary to ensure quality.

After assembly, the T-shirts are checked for flaws. Not every piece passes the inspection. Some may have uneven seams or misaligned prints. Quality control is essential but can be overlooked in a rush. Finally, T-shirts are packaged and prepared for distribution. Yet, the journey doesn’t always end there; feedback from customers often leads to further improvements.

Printing Techniques for T-Shirt Designs

When it comes to T-shirt manufacturing, printing techniques play a crucial role. Each method offers unique advantages and challenges. Screen printing is one of the most popular techniques. It allows for vibrant colors and durable designs. However, it requires a setup for each color used. This can lead to high initial costs and longer production times.

Direct-to-garment (DTG) printing has gained traction recently. It produces high-quality images directly onto the fabric. This method is great for complex designs. Yet, it may not be as cost-effective for large runs. The ink may also fade faster than screen printing.

Heat transfer printing is another method worth mentioning. It transfers a design from a special paper onto the shirt using heat. This technique is easy to learn, but it can result in a less breathable finish. Moreover, the quality varies based on the equipment used. This highlights the need for careful choice of method based on the intended design and production scale. Each technique has strengths and weaknesses. Understanding these can help in making informed decisions for any T-shirt manufacturing project.

Quality Control and Final Product Assessment

Quality control in T-shirt manufacturing is crucial. It ensures that each product meets specific standards. According to industry reports, over 70% of consumers expect high-quality materials and stitching. However, achieving this consistency can be challenging.

Final product assessment involves multiple stages. Manufacturers often perform visual inspections to check for defects. They also measure fabric durability and color fastness. Notably, about 10% of T-shirts fail quality tests due to poor stitching or fading colors. This raises concerns about supplier reliability and material sourcing.

Despite rigorous processes, mistakes still occur. Sometimes, batches can be mislabeled or sizes can be inconsistent. This not only affects customer satisfaction but also increases return rates. Reports indicate that a high return rate can lead to losses upwards of 15% in revenue. Ultimately, maintaining quality requires ongoing reflection and adaptation in manufacturing practices.
